The warfare within the Gaza Strip turns 116 days this Tuesday underneath rising hopes concerning the truce proposal of a number of phases outlined within the assembly held final Sunday in Paris by the intelligence chiefs of the US, Israel and Egypt and the Qatari prime minister. All of them, with a better or lesser diploma of optimism, are ready for the response from the Islamist group Hamas, which, alternatively, early within the morning misplaced considered one of its members of the armed wing when he was shot by Israeli brokers who entered Yenn hospital dressed as medical doctors and girls.

Following Israel's preliminary inexperienced gentle to the ceasefire framework, in keeping with leaks in Israeli and American media, Hamas chief Ismail Haniyah introduced that his group “Study the proposal and be open to all ideas“to place an finish to the large offensive within the Gaza Strip. “The priority is to stop the brutal aggression and the complete withdrawal of the occupation forces,” mentioned Haniyah, who will maintain consultations this Wednesday in Cairo, the place there’s optimism. According to l, the reply can be “soon” though the final phrase goes to the chief of Hamas in Gaza, Yahia Sinwar. For now, Islamic Jihad warns that it’ll reject any settlement that doesn’t embody a whole truce and the withdrawal of Israeli troopers who started their floor operation on the finish of October.

First section

The first section will embody a 45-day ceasefire, the mass launch of Palestinian prisoners (together with these convicted of homicide), the numerous improve in humanitarian support to Gaza, underneath a dramatic humanitarian disaster and the discharge of 35 to 40 kidnapped folks (ladies, aged and sick) of the 136 nonetheless in captivity because the assault on October 7 in Israel. The second and third phases set up the discharge of younger Israelis kidnapped on the Nova music pageant and of the troopers and at last of adults, troopers and corpses. In return, Hamas would obtain a pause of longer period of truce and quite a few prisoners together with these convicted of great assaults. Their quantity should nonetheless be agreed upon though Hamas aspires for 1000’s and maybe all those that are in Israeli prisons. Sinwar hopes that the truce can be his private salvation and that of the militia because the regime that has managed the Palestinian enclave since 2007. Precisely because of this, the Israeli authorities affirm that they’re in favor of a pause within the operation – to free the hostages – however not its full cessation.

What is cooked in Paris, whether it is saved with the identical recipe, tendra una difcil digestin en Jerusalin, the place essentially the most ultranationalist sector in Benjamin Netanyahu's coalition opposes the lasting cessation of the warfare towards Hamas and the discharge of 1000’s of Palestinian prisoners. “Reckless agreement = dismantlement of the Government,” warned the far-right minister Itamar Ben Gvir on the and the opposition's safety community, it will be an infinite problem of their try to proceed in energy and keep away from elections.

“I hear statements about all kinds of agreements, so I want to make it clear: we will not end this war without meeting the objectives which are the elimination of Hamas, the return of all our kidnapped people and the guarantee that Gaza no longer represents a threat to Israel“, clarified Netanyahu who warned: “We will not remove the Army from the Strip nor will we release thousands of terrorists.” His phrases provoked criticism amongst some households of kidnapped folks as they had been formulated at essential moments within the negotiation.

Israeli warning contrasts with the optimism filtered by the mediators who’ve accelerated their efforts to finish the worst warfare in reminiscence between Israel and Hamas that started virtually 4 months in the past.

day by day raids

The Hamas 7-O terrorist assault in southern Israel brought about not solely a devastating navy response within the Gaza Strip but in addition a rise within the variety of Israeli operations towards militias within the West Bank with virtually day by day raids. But what was seen on the Ibn Sina hospital in Jenin just isn’t routine. Disguised as locals (bogs or a girl with a child seat), brokers from an undercover unit entered the well being middle earlier than six within the morning and went to the room positioned on the third ground the place Mohamed Jalamneh (Hamas) and the brothers Mohamed and Basel Ghazawi (Islamic Jihad) had been hiding. ).

After capturing the three members of the so-called Yenn Brigade with weapons fitted with silencers, They left the hospital in a deadly 10-minute surgical treatment of particular forces of the Police, the inner secret service and the Army. “Jalamneh was in contact with Hamas abroad, transferred weapons and ammunition to terrorists to promote armed attacks and planned an imminent attack inspired by the October 7 massacre,” they indicated in a press release by which they denounced “another example of the cynical use of civilian areas and hospitals as shelters and human shields by terrorist organizations.

The images captured by the hospital's security camera – typical of the Fauda series – were seen in a radically different way by the Palestinian National Authority (PNA), which defined the operation as “new bloodbath of the occupation and warfare crime“. The ANP called on the UN to “put an finish to the day by day crimes dedicated by the occupation towards our folks and well being facilities within the Gaza Strip and the West Bank.”
